Connect all the destinations with a network of crosses - the first person to achieve this on their game sheet is the winner of "Kannste Knicken". Sounds simple? Certainly, if only there weren't a large number of targets on the back of the sheet. To reach them with the crosses, the players have to combine and fold cleverly - always with the progress of the other players firmly in mind. Because only the fastest wins the game. The new Roll & Write game from the successful authors Klaus-Jürgen Wrede and Ralph Querfurth expands the popular "Klein & Fein" series from Schmidt Spiele this spring.

Dice, cross, bend - in "Kannste Knicken" up to four players aged eight and up try to reach all the goals faster than the others. Each player receives a sheet of paper, a pencil and off they go. As soon as the dice are rolled, the active player gets to choose one of the two results. The other die is at the free disposal of the remaining players. Now the clever crosses begin: Each player enters the number of dice as rows of crosses on his or her sheet, whereby some conditions must be observed - for example, they must always connect to existing start-end points of the path network and run in a straight line. It is therefore necessary to work your way to the targets faster than the others, but most of them are located on the back of the sheets. To get to them, the players must reach intermediate goals. The more they achieve, the bigger the corner that can be turned - and that gives a player attractive permanent bonuses. Only the player who cleverly crosses, bends and finds the right mix can be the first to cross off all the targets and win.

The novelty from the "Klein & Fein" series can be played in several levels, which provide variety and high voltage, as well as in the solo variant.
